Show Notes
In November 2010, a family from Kapunda, Australia were found dead in their home. They had been the victims of a vile, frenzied and evil attack.
In a town that had almost no crime, a triple murder was the last thing anyone thought could happen, especially to the Rowe family. They were loved, respected and had many friends in their community.
But there was a serial killer in town and it was one of the most unlikely suspects....
